What It Is

CanBoat / NautiSavoir is a Canadian boating education and certification platform for recreational boaters, operated by Canadian Power and Sail Squadrons / Escadrilles canadiennes de plaisance. The site focuses on PCOC boating licenses, VHF marine radio certification, and skills courses covering navigation, boat handling, docking, tides, coastal cruising, and more.

Core Courses and Certifications

Its core product is the PCOC, the certificate required to legally operate a powered boat in Canada. The page clearly states that this Operator Card course is approved by Transport Canada, and is the only course in Canada approved by the National Association of State Boating Law Administrators while also being officially recognized by the US Coast Guard. Once the PCOC test is passed, it is valid for life, with no annual fees or renewal required, and is marked as valid in both Canada and the United States. Another key offering is the VHF Marine Radio Course, used to obtain VHF Radio Certification / ROC-M, helping boaters master marine communications, distress calls, DSC functions, and on-water communication skills.

Course Formats and Coverage

The course formats are fairly flexible, with the main text mentioning three options: online, classroom, and self-study. For beginners or those needing a refresher, the platform offers 2-hour online mini-courses on common pain points such as docking and tides. More advanced options include Basic Navigation & Boat Handling, as well as the Seamanship and Coastal Navigation Course for those preparing for coastal and Great Lakes cruising. Overall, the course pathway is fairly complete, ranging from certification and safety to practical boating skill development.

Pricing

The online PCOC course and card are priced at $49.95, tax free, making this the most clearly disclosed fee on the page. Membership costs $60, and members receive a 20% course discount while joining an organization centered on safety, education, community activities, and connections with fellow boaters. Prices for other courses are not shown in the main text, so they still need to be confirmed before purchase.

Pros and Cons

Its strengths include strong certification backing, lifetime validity for the PCOC, a course system that covers both beginner and advanced levels, and practical content tailored to Canadian waters. The organization’s background also adds credibility. The drawbacks are that pricing transparency is incomplete, and the page does not explain teaching languages, refund policies, customer support, or exam process details. Its regulatory relevance is also clearly centered on Canada, so non-Canadian users will need to confirm applicability on their own.
